окно.open() не работает в приложении iOS с помощью phone gap

Я пишу приложение ios с помощью Phonegap, все, что мне нужно в моем приложении, это когда phonegap вызовет индекс.html страница html перенаправит пользователя на мой веб-сайт дело в том, что HTML не перенаправляет приложение на мой сайт, я не забота, если телефон разрыв открыть safari мне просто нужно перенаправить его на мой сайт мой код есть:

<html>
<head>
<script type="text/javascript">
    function loadlink()
    {
        window.open("www.cnn.com");
    }
</script>
</head>
<body onload="loadlink()">        
</body>
</html>

2 ответов


Сделайте свою функцию такой:

function loadlink() {
  window.location.href = "www.cnn.com";
}

или еще лучше

function loadlink() {
    if (typeof (window.open) == "function") {
        window.open("http://www.stackoverflow.com");
    }
    else {
        window.location.href = "http://www.stackoverflow.com";
    }
}

Так как Internet Explorer не очень нравится с окном.местоположение.хреф!--2-->